The 2025 3M Open: A Breakdown of the Action at TPC Twin Cities

The PGA Tour once again lit up TPC Twin Cities during the eagerly anticipated 3M Open, demonstrating why this tournament has become synonymous with thrilling golf. As competitors stepped onto the lush greens, expectations soared for a birdie bonanza, and they were not disappointed. This year’s action saw familiar names rise to the top as they sought to claim a piece of the substantial prize purse.

High Expectations: Birdie Fest at TPC Twin Cities

Every year, when the PGA Tour lands at TPC Twin Cities for the 3M Open, fans anticipate a captivating display of golf. The course’s design encourages players to go low, and the past results speak for themselves. In 2024, Jhonattan Vegas clinched victory at an impressive 17-under-par, while Lee Hodges dazzled with a staggering 24-under the year before. It’s not just a tournament; it’s a showcase of the best in golf where birdies abound.

Record-Breaking Performances

The 2025 edition of the tournament continued in the same vein, with players delivering stellar performances right from the outset. Canadian golfer Adam Svensson set ablaze the scorecard with a tournament record of 11-under-par 60 in the first round. Unfortunately, he struggled to maintain that pace in subsequent rounds, providing a rollercoaster of emotion for his fans.

Kurt Kitayama’s Surge to Victory

While Svensson lit up the leaderboards initially, it was Kurt Kitayama who emerged as the ultimate victor. Opening his campaign with rounds of 65 and 71, Kitayama found himself contending but needing to lift his game. When he fired his own remarkable 60 on Saturday, he surged back into contention, showcasing the resilience that champions are made of.

Kitayama had not tasted victory since his win at the 2023 Arnold Palmer Invitational, making this win all the more significant. Coming into Sunday, he faced a tightly packed leaderboard featuring several other talented golfers, heightening the stakes as he vied for the title.

The Climactic Final Round

As the final round unfolded at TPC Twin Cities, nerves were palpable. Leaders Akshay Bhatia and Thorbjorn Olesen, who had occupied the top spots as 54-hole leaders, couldn’t maintain their momentum and faltered. This opened the door for Kitayama, who seized the moment and showcased his talent to secure the lead.

With competitors like Sam Stevens and Jake Knapp pushing against him, Kitayama’s ability to navigate the pressure was on full display as he fended off challenges to ultimately secure the title. His victory not only granted him prestige but also a hefty reward of $1.512 million—proof that hard work and perseverance pay off.

Payout Breakdown: What Every Player Made at the 2025 3M Open

One of the highlights of the 3M Open is the substantial prize money distributed to the participants. As the 2025 tournament concluded, players walked away with different figures based on their performances. The payout for the victor, Kitayama, was an eye-popping $1.512 million. Here’s a detailed breakdown:

  1. Kurt Kitayama: $1.512 million
  2. Akshay Bhatia: $915,600
  3. Thorbjorn Olesen: $579,600
  4. Sam Stevens: $411,600
  5. Jake Knapp: $344,400
  6. Turner Ransom: $304,500
  7. Alex Smalley: $283,500
  8. Kevin Tway: $262,500
  9. Matt Kuchar: $245,700
  10. Billy Horschel: $228,900

The figures reveal how even those who finished down the leaderboard still earned substantial amounts—an attractive incentive for professional golfers.
